Let Natural Light Brighten Your Home

Natural light makes every room feel larger, cleaner, and more inviting. Open your curtains during the day and keep windows free from heavy decorations. If natural light is limited, choose soft white LED bulbs to create a bright and comfortable atmosphere.

Choose Furniture That Fits Your Space

Buying oversized furniture can make a room feel crowded. Measure your space before purchasing sofas, tables, or cabinets. Furniture that matches the size of your room creates a balanced and organized appearance while allowing people to move comfortably.

Use Decorative Accessories Carefully

Accessories should improve your home's appearance without creating clutter. A decorative vase, a framed picture, a stylish clock, or a woven basket can add personality to your room. Choose a few meaningful pieces instead of filling every shelf.

Add Soft Fabrics for Comfort

Soft curtains, decorative cushions, cozy blankets, and comfortable rugs make every room feel warmer and more welcoming. Mixing different fabrics also creates visual depth and gives your home a more luxurious appearance.

Keep Every Room Neat and Organized

Clean spaces always look more attractive than cluttered ones. Store everyday items in cabinets, baskets, or storage boxes. Regular cleaning and proper organization help your home feel peaceful while making daily life easier.

Bring Nature Indoors

Natural elements create a calm and relaxing atmosphere. Indoor plants, wooden furniture, stone decorations, or fresh flowers add beauty while making your home feel connected to nature. Even one small plant can make a noticeable difference.

Create a Personal Style

Your home should reflect your personality. Display family photographs, travel memories, favorite books, or handmade decorations. These personal touches make every room unique and welcoming without following every design trend.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1. How can I make my home look more expensive on a budget?

Focus on cleanliness, good lighting, neutral colors, soft fabrics, and simple decorative accessories. Small improvements often create the biggest visual impact.

Q2. What are the easiest ways to improve a small room?

Use light-colored walls, mirrors, natural lighting, multifunctional furniture, and keep unnecessary items out of sight.

Q3. Are indoor plants necessary for home decoration?

No, but they are highly recommended because they add freshness, natural beauty, and create a more relaxing atmosphere.

Q4. How often should I refresh my home decor?

Small seasonal changes, such as new cushion covers, fresh flowers, or decorative accessories, are enough to keep your home looking fresh throughout the year.
